Education and Fellowship Training 

Dr. Moshfegh graduated with honors from the University of California, Berkeley, earning a bachelor’s degree in molecular and cellular biology. He went on to receive his medical degree from New York Medical College.

He completed his internship and radiology residency at the UCLA Kaiser Permanente Center, where he finished a mini-fellowship in interventional radiology and was recognized as a scholar of the Society of Interventional Radiology. His training culminated with a fellowship in vascular and interventional radiology at Cornell-NY Presbyterian Hospital and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center, where he refined his expertise in advanced, catheter-based vascular procedures.

Procedures Dr. Moshfegh Performs

Dr. Moshfegh offers a broad range of minimally invasive vascular treatments. His areas of focus include:

  • Uterine fibroid embolization (UFE), a minimally invasive treatment that reduces blood flow to uterine fibroids while preserving the uterus
  • Genicular artery embolization (GAE) for selected patients with chronic knee pain associated with osteoarthritis
  • Peripheral artery disease (PAD) treatment and complex arterial interventions
  • Varithena microfoam ablation for varicose veins and chronic venous insufficiency
  • Sclerotherapy for problem veins
  • Venous ulcer and non-healing leg wound care
  • Endovascular Aneurysm Repair
  • Kyphoplasty for painful vertebral compression fractures

Across these procedures, Dr. Moshfegh may use imaging technologies such as intravascular ultrasound (IVUS) to evaluate blood vessels and guide selected interventions.
